~You are Sigmund Wagner, sole survivor of the Ulvenacht which left your village a charnel house. You alone were spared death by the hand of Lector Gwynneau Tylmarine, a Paladin and master of the stronghold known as The Castle of Bells. She took you under her protection and brought you to her home to give you an opportunity at a life that you would have otherwise lost to the horrors of the night. ~

This morning is like many others, but unlike them as well. For today is the day you take the Mark of Measure, a test to gauge your status both as a Paladin and as one of the Faithful. You rise from your bed, dress for the day, clean your face of the small stubble that has started to grow, finally after sixteen years, and tie your two swords to your waist. You descend down the stairs and hear the sound of Gwyn singing her Vigors, stirring your mind and body, as well as everyone else in the castle, with the divine song of morning.

You head into the Great Hall and through it to the kitchen. The cooking staff is up and has already prepared meals for Gwyn, you, and the soldiery. The head chef, a one armed man name Garond, waves his cleaver at you, "Oi! Good morning, Sigmund. Here for your meal? It's hash this morning, potatoes and beef." You thank him after bidding him good morning and take the plate he pushes towards you, eating and half-listening to the hustle of the kitchen.

You know that this afternoon several Paladins will be arriving to test you, if they find you capable, they will report your good work to Gwyn. If they find you exceptional, you could be accelerated on your path to full Paladin status. You wolf down your meal,strech, and stretch, then head to...

You thank Garond for the meal and head upstairs to the library. Passing by Master Durmon with a good morning wave, you delve into your studies. With all possible speed you begin to research the Mark of Measure.

"The Mark of Measure is an optional test, issued to those young Acolytes whose Masters believe can triumph over it. There are three elements to the test; the Test of Faith, the Test of Purity, and the Test of Strength. It is impossible to fully detail what possible actions may need to be taken by the student, and his effort is taken into account when the final measure is made, but the universal truth is to remain dedicated to the values of one's Path and the teaching of one's master."

You take note of it and begin reading some examples of Marks in the past...


"Sir Tormin, Age 17, Path of the Bastion. First Test: Walked through a column of flame, bare as a babe, emerged unharmed. Second Test: Was told to decide the fate of a murderer. Showed mercy and restrained, bound the man to his side to ensure his good behavior and granted him a page. Third Test: Battled against a werewolf alone, Emerged triumphant and unharmed."

Others go on to detail further acts of varying degrees of difficulty. You have faith in your abilities to handle this correctly, but you wish to more than just pass, you want to excel. It could mean your movement to Paladin within a week!

"The Test of Faith is considered to be the second most difficult test of the Mark. A student must be willing to endure pain, shame, hardship, and adversity to achieve his victory. The test may be as simple as catching an arrow between the teeth, or as difficult as climbing a mountain with one's bare hands. This Test can last up to a week, if the Master is particularly cruel."

You blink several times in surprise. A whole week!? The idea of the Mark being any longer than a few hours starts to weaken in your mind as you consider what they could make you do. Reflecting on the tenets of being a Paladin; Justice to all Men, Courage before all Foes, Wisdom in all Things, and Endurance to all pains, you realize that it could be many many different tasks.

"Squire Sigmund," Merea's voice comes from the door as you turn to face her, and she bows, "A hundred apologies, sir, but Lady Gwyn wanted me to make certain that you didn't want to ask her anything before your Mark is done. She cannot help and won't even be at the Mark."

"Master Gwyn, what were your Marks, and how did you pass?" She blinks a few times and answers quickly,

"I didn't. I failed my Marks."

You bite your lip before coughing and mutter out, "I'm sorry, Master, I didn't mean to bring up such a..." She waves her hand, cutting you off, "It's fine. It's a natural question to ask. My first Mark was to climb a pillar of blades without cutting my hand. I passed that one without a problem. My next Mark was to determine if a mother who blasphemed against a Temple of the Seven by stealing its holy relic and selling it should be taken from her child and put in prison. I said yes. I was mistaken." She sighs, "The Marks aren't necessary, they don't make you a Paladin. However, the fact that I failed them has bothered me since I was 16."

You nod and wait a moment, the silence between you somewhat heavy before you ask, "Well, do you think I can succeed?" A corner of her lip curls up as she nods, "Yes, Squire, I think you can succeed. I would not have selected you, or selected the Masters I did for you, if I doubted your abilities. You are a pious man, and a good young man. You are strong and bold. I have no question that you will be an admirable Paladin."

When she finishes talking she steps forward and you can see, for the first time in a while with her so near, how much taller you have become. It was only six years ago that you stood at her stomach, but now, she stands at your shoulder. She reaches up, going up on her toes a bit, and ties a leather cord around your neck. The symbol of the Seven Gods lands softly against your chest as she nods. "It is a blessed necklace. Show faith and it will reward you." Her sharp blue eyes glint in the candlelight as she salutes you and you kneel to her, "Now, go be ready. They should arrive within the hour."

You head back up to the library and do some last minute study before the sound of horns fill the air.

With nervousness in your stomach you head downstairs, muttering a prayer to the Gods for your success. The doors to the Foyer are thrown open and three figures step forward. You kneel and extend an arm, "Welcome to our home, Masters, thank you for coming all this way."

The head of the group is an aged and withered man with a large hook nose and a look on his face of vinegar on his tongue. He clutches a heavy staff and though it would seem that he needs to lean on it for support, instead, he walks tall and strong.

Flanking him on both sides are two young women, one with black hair the other with white. They are dressed identically and seem to be otherwise perfect mirrors of one another, a mace on their hips and a smile on their faces.

The man speaks first, a coarse and harsh voice, "We are grateful for your courtesy, Squire-Acolyte Wagner. I am Count Bartolo the Indictor. Behind me are my granddaughters, Corellia and Lorenica. The three of us will be administering your Marks today. Please come with us to the Muster Field, we have cleared the area."

The four of you head down to the area just outside the barracks but, sadly for you, no soldiers are present or near. In fact, the castle's courtyard feels emptier than it ever has before. An area is set up with Bartolo's banner planted in the ground. He steps away and stands by the fence, as does one of his relatives. The remaining woman bows her head politely and speaks.

"I am Corellia the Testifier, and I will be issuing your Test of Faith. Are you prepared?"

You raise your arm and plunge your hand deep into the lava without hesitation. As you feel the warmth building around your arm you imagine a sword, a strong beautiful sword. Your mind leaps around and envisions many things; Gwyn, the Castle, Harmon, your mother, the attack, so many things, before it eventually settles on the image of Gwyn as she came and saved you that night so many years ago.

You wrench your hand up from the lava, the bar of steel now formed into a long and elegant sword, narrow and with a powerful point. It features a leaf-like section towards the tip and its metal around the handle is twisted and beautiful in its grace. You breathe out slowly, glad that the moment has passed.

"Congratulations, Squire Wagner, you have passed my Test." Corellia bows her head and steps back. Her sister steps forward for the Test of Purity and bows to you, speaking in a voice identical to her sister.

"I am Lorenica the Pious. Your Test of Piety begins now. I ask you a simple question, answer correctly and you pass."

She clears her throat and extends her left hand to the side. Light dances around it and forms a figure of a bent woman. "Is it better, Squire, to live in willing denial of the God's wills, forsaking prayer and offering, but living to their code? Or," she extends her other hand, the figure of a fat man yelling appearing, "Is it better to live in unknowing vice?"

"I will face the foe within." You say boldly and place the sword on the ground. He smiles darkly at your words and steps towards you, "Very well then, let submit to my hand." You nod and he places his palm against your forehead. The feel of his hard leathery hand is the last you remember before you leave your body.

~~~~~~~

You breathe in quickly and sit upright. You are submerged up to your armpits in warm water. The room you are in is full of steam and makes you feel lightheaded. You hear giggling from the other side of the body of water. "Who's there?" You call out and hear movement towards you and the two women slowly swim closer, the water coming up just short of their necks. From the appearance of their shoulders, they appear to be as undressed as you.

"It's only us, brave Squire. You have done excellent work on the tests, and are fair to look upon. Let us show you how good of a job you did," they purr in unison towards you. Both sisters raise their arms and gesture towards you with a single bidding finger.

"Turn aside, temptresses. Such simple ploys will not work on me." You close your eyes and steel your mind. They draw closer, hands begin darting across your shoulders, but instead of submitting you push them both aside and swim forward. "I have no business with you, and I do not wish your acquaintance."

Their voices and giggles fade into silence as you step further through the mist. Distantly, you can see a light, far away, and begin heading towards it. "That wasn't so hard." You mutter and keep walking as you hear a voice echo, "Oh, Siggy, dearest...."

You turn and see the red hair and sharp blue eyes of Gwyn looking up at you from the water. She smiles, and you've never seen her with any sort of cosmetic on, yet she looks more lovely than ever before. A part of you warms you that this is wrong, she's almost your mother. But another part sees Gwyn as a woman, older than you, yes, but still a woman. She draws nearer.

"You've grown up into such a big strong man. Why don't you show me?" She says as she draws nearer.

"What is this, Bartolo?! Some sort of perverse trick!?" You yell up as you feel, almost as if he were telling you, that this is just a place within your own mind, and he is showing you the thoughts in your head, not in his.

"Gwyn..." You start as she draws close. Keeping your distance carefully you start talking, "You know this is not proper. Yes...I would be deceiving you if I were not to admit that you are fair, but you are a mother to me. You raised and protected me. I don't want this. Please, enough." She stops and you can see the lascivious fire drain from her eyes as she draws close and gives you a gentle embrace before vanishing.

You turn and walk boldly for the exit, the white light washing over you as you close your eyes and smile.

~~~~~~~

The heavy hand of Bartolo is removed from your forehead as he nods, "You have done well, child. I recognize you as having passed the Test of Strength without failure. You embraced the most difficult truth of being a man and endured, as a Paladin should."

The old man steps back and taps his staff on the ground, "By my authority as Indictor and Master of your Mark, I grant you the honor of a complete success and will give my recommendation for you to become a Paladin to your Master."

You bow and he nods solemnly, "Please rise, Squire, it has been quite a while since I have seen a novice succeed so greatly. Be proud of your achievements, and keep the knowledge of your triumph over adversity close to your heart." He taps your knee with his staff and gives an ugly wrinkled smile, "Now, I am off to talk to Gwyn, please, entertain my dear granddaughters."

And with that the old man strolls up towards the castle. The two women draw closer and bow, politely, "Congratulations on your success, Squire Wagner."

"Yes, Master Gwyn, I am ready." She nods and before she can speak you offer her the sword, "However, before we go further, I would like to offer you this gift of my Mark, as a small token of my thanks for your years of dedication and kindness. Thank you very much, Gwyn." She takes the sword and nods her head, not speaking as she swallows and bows her head to you deeply. "Master Bartolo, please, instruct him on the test, I must return this to my armory." Her voice is wavering slightly as she heads away.

Bartolo steps in and begins talking, "Now, Squire Wagner, the way to becoming a Paladin is markedly easier than your Mark. All that you must do is don the Ur-Armor of your Path, which can be created by any Paladin for the purposes of this ceremony. Then, once wearing the armor of your forebears, you must kneel in prayer for an entire night and abstain from sleep. When the dawn touches the hem of your cloak, you may rise and remove the armor, but no longer as a Squire, but as a Paladin."

You nod and he continues, "You may, of course, bring an attendant with you, one who is forbidden to speak, but may give you water every hour and ensure that you remain awake. Who would you like to bring with you?"

"I would like Master Gwyn to come with me. I trust her most." He nods and smiles, "The bond between the two of you is very strong, I can see. I am sorry for what you endured in your mind, but you are the better man for doing so." His granddaughters leave and he takes you back up to the Castle where Gwyn is waiting, sitting in the Chapel at prayer. "Rise, Lady Gwyn," Bartolo intones gravely, the young woman jumping to her feet, "You must serve the duty of Vigilant at the behest of this Squire, do you accept?"

The words hadn't left his mouth for a moment before she barked out, "Yes! I would serve gladly." He gives a chuckle and gestures for her to lead the way. She takes the three of you to the enclave where you first saw her statuettes of the gods and she has you kneel in front of the altar. As you do so she gestures and chants a few words and you feel the weight of impressive armor settle over you. Your eyes are fixed upon the inscription on the wall. "I will see you again in the morning, Squire Wagner. Do with Faith in all things." And with that, Bartolo steps out of the room.

The armor features a pair of sweeping shoulders that lead up to your sallet style helm which you wear with great comfort. The minutes tick by into hours and as you grow weary you see visions and hear sounds. The first wearer of this armor fought many great foes and dedicated his life to the good fight against the Horrors of the world. He was not like the Vanguard, who leaped after dragons and smote them from the skies, nor was he like the Bastion, unshakable and implacable. He certainly wasn't the Minister, whose voice rang with the authority of the Gods.

No, the Sentinel was the poorest and most humble of the Ur-Paladins. He would defend the Innocent and wicked alike from injustices. He was devout, but not a zealot. He was stern, but not unwelcoming.

His undoing was met when his good nature was betrayed.

A woman, to whom he had sworn his honor, was purchased by the carnal power of vile devils and tempters. She was weak, and when he slept, she stole his armor and blade, leaving him bare before the hordes of vile horrors that sought his end.

Yet, still, unarmored and weaponless, he stood and delivered. Using his righteous fury and the power of his soul, he battled against the seemingly endless tides of demons, vampires, and fae who wished him dead. A blade, borne of his purity of heart, and which answered to his Zielrand styles that he had developed, danced a vicious dance of death, ending many hundred of the monsters.

He did not even allow them the pleasure of his corpse, for the use of this blade for the days he fought against them drained him until, finally, he was no longer able to expose his soul so boldly, and he vanished into the air leaving only a pile of the dead in his wake, and the knowledge of his swordcraft.

A feeling of warmth fills you as you turn your head and see the light of the sun shining through a window and touching the base of your cape. Gwyn, who had been faithfully standing by you, smiles and breaks her vigil. "I am pleased to be the one you chose, Sigmund. Thank you for allowing me the honor of being the first to congratulate you, Sir Sigmund."

You stand and the armor vanishes from you in the same manner the Ur-Sentinel did. She extends her hand and you grip it firmly with your own. The two of you shake and she nods her head, wearily, "I am certain Bartolo will wish to speak, but I must sing my Vigors." She pardons herself and exits to go sing.

You step forth and Bartolo raises his staff, "Praise be to the Gods! Hail to you, Sir Sigmund!" You raise your hand and smile, triumphantly.

An hour passes as the area is prepared for your ordainment and you are offered pure water, blessed by Bartolo's hand itself, to bathe yourself and ready yourself. You stand after wiping yourself dry and breathe in and out slowly, excitement thundering through your heart. It finally happened, you tell yourself, you finally have become a Paladin. A Sentinel.

The call goes out for you to step forth from the enclave into the Chapel. The visitors of the day are seated and glance at you with anticipation. Some of the faces have seen you grow from a child into the man you are today. The voice of Gwyn fills the air, the Vigors that you have woken to every day for the past eight years reaches you and Bartolo ushers you forth.

You stand at the head of the Chapel and kneel. The twins bring a silver gauntlet and a chalice on a cushion before you. Their grandfather raises his staff and speaks sonorously.

"Today we stand in deep appreciation for the blessings of the Gods. They have given us another blade against the dark, and another shield against the ravages of the wicked. Today, dear Innocents and Blessed alike, we stand at the anointment of a Paladin." He presses the head of his staff against your head and asks deeply.

"Sigmund Wagner, are you prepared to deliver Justice to all Men, to show Courage before all Foes, to bear Wisdom in all Things, and to carry Endurance to all Pains, under the pain of death and dishonor, so may the Gods bind you?"

You nod your head solemnly, "Yes, I do so swear it." He nods and takes the gauntlet, "Then with this, the hand of the Eldest God, do I offer you a drink of the Sacred Chalice, which will grant you the first step on your road beyond the Innocent."

You take up the Chalice and slowly drink from it. The water is cool, but once inside of you, fills you with fire and a desire for justice.

You rise to roaring applause as the Vigors end. Your eyes drift up to see Gwyn standing and looking down on you with a smile. She nods and you nod back. A great feast is held and you enjoy drink and song and excellent food.

Finally, late at night after everyone has gone and the party is past, you are pulled into the enclave with Gwyn. She appears nervous, shuffling her feet and unsure of where to put her eyes. It is strange for you to see her this way. You begin to speak as she cuts you off.

"So, you are fully realized. A Sentinel, a Paladin, and a grown man. I'm very proud to see you come this far so early, Sigmund." She says with a small smile. You return it, "Well, I wouldn't have made it this far without such an excellent teacher." Gwyn laughs gently and looks out the window.

"You're an errant now, and as a Paladin there are strict rules about where you can live and with whom. So, I cannot keep you here, sadly. You must go on your own way and find your own Stronghold, or just live as an Errant. I'm sorry." She says and lowers her head.

You reach out and grab her, pulling her into your chest. She lets out a noise of surprise before sighing, "Oh Sigmund...." She says with a laugh and returns it. The two of you embrace for a while before eventually, and somewhat awkwardly, she shuffles out of it and smiles, a bit less stern and calm than usual as she gives a weary smile, "Alright, help yourself to anything in the armory, and a horse from the stable. Merea will prepare a bag for you and I'll have Durmon find a map of the area."

The two of you walk into the armory and you pick a fine suit of plates, some chain and padded cloth to go underneath it, and a large kite shield. "I know you've gotten fond of using two swords, but a shield is still helpful against arrows and other such foul works out in the world." You nod and don the armor, sling the shield to your back, tighten your swordbelt and gather the supplies she gave you.

Everyone present, servants and soldiers and Gwyn, gather on the steps of the castle to bid you farewell. You have chosen a brown horse with a white star on its nose as your steed and bid everyone farewell. With a heavy heart, and a strange feeling of excitement, you head out of the keep's gate and consult the map by light of the stars.

You turn your horse to the West, deciding it would be best to take this chance to make a name for yourself and see the world outside of the villages and the wilds. Apparently, the Great Holds to the West are home to many of your fellow Paladins visiting for pilgrimage.

~Many days ride later~

After days of crossing rolling plains and smooth roads you arrive at the walls of a large keep squatting on the road. By the time you have drawn near a group of guards ride out, heavily armored and armed. Their leader stabs his lance into the grass and rides towards you in a gesture of willingness to speak.

"Hail, traveler! Know that you are entering the lands of Sir Olondre, Keeper of the Border. What business do you have heading to Font Florenne?"

The man relaxes and removes his helmet, "Ah, forgive me, your Honor, I had no intentions of appearing rude to a noble Paladin. Yes, news comes to us by the day, and each time it leaves with ten more of my men. Several of your brothers and sisters are leading a valiant effort, but those damn skullmongers are hard to track down, and the stuff they do with the dead makes me right sick, your Honor." He says with a shake of his head. The man is older, gray has started to touch his temples and his beard as well. He bows his head, "Come, sir, let us welcome you properly."

You and the guards are let into the Keep, your horse stabled, and your pack refreshed. A runner is sent from the stables and returns quickly, "Begging your pardon, your Honor, but our Lord wishes to speak to you." You consent, of course, and head inside, helm under your arm.

"Hail, noble Paladin! I am Sir Olondre." The loud, nay thunderous, voice of the man in the great hall fills the room as he stands and walks towards you. This man was once, perhaps a great warrior, but now has gotten older and much heavier. He bows sweepingly to you and you nod, allowing him to rise.

Your hands grow warm and golden light begins to pour from them as the wound shifts from green and disgusting to flesh color and then closes itself. The man's skin begins to return to a pale, but human, color and he seems far more relaxed in his rest.

Olondre laughs and claps your back with a ham-like fist, "What a show! This man should recover in a week at most, but you have very well spared him from death. Ah...what a blessing to see you at such a time." The two of you return to the great hall and he sits you in a chair opposite his throne.

"I must be honest with you, lad, despite our success in Daggerwood, the fae continue to advance, and the forest draws nearer and nearer. Normally, if it weren't so near, we would just put the torch to it and drive out those damnable fae, but we have found their efforts more organized and more aggressive than usual for these things. You must understand, I've dealt with the fae for fifteen years at this point, but about six years ago they suddenly became more and more daring."

He clamps a pipe between his teeth and starts to smoke it, grumbling into his beard as he mutters out, "Damn forest used to be almost two miles away, now it's less than a half mile away and it gets closer by the day. I lose more villagers to that forest than anything else put together. I need something to help turn the tide."
